  "account": "Chief Commercial Officer Tobin W. Juvenal of Castle Biosciences Inc. recently disposed of 1,730 shares of the company's common stock, amounting to a total sale value of $51,190. This transaction took place on August 17, 2026, and was conducted within the confines of a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an, which Juvenal had established on December 10, 2025. The shares were sold at a price fluctuating between $29.21 and $30.01, with an average sale price of $29.59 per share. Post-transaction, Juvenal remains a beneficial owner of 75,964 shares of Castle Biosciences common stock. As of the latest trading, the stock is priced at $33.42, marking a 44% increase over the past year, although analysis indicates it may be overvalued at present. Despite the company not being profitable in the last twelve months, Castle Biosciences has demonstrated robust performance in recent months. BTIG recently upped its price target for the stock to $44, maintaining a Buy rating, after the company reported stronger-than-expected second-quarter results, surpassing analysts' estimates for both profit and revenue.",
